I often feel as though I'm running on 'empty' — with a thousand phone calls coming in, words to write, meals to make, problems to solve... it can feel like I'm just going, going, going. Do you ever feel that way?
Like a teapot, we can continue pouring into all our various cups... our family, friends, homes, jobs. We aren't aware that our hearts, minds, and souls are almost empty until suddenly, we have nothing left to give.
However, once we allow ourselves to get all the way down to completely empty, we find that we're no longer able to be good stewards of the things which God has entrusted to us. In order to not only stay sane for our own sake, but love our little ones with a patient, gracious heart, we must have our cup abundantly filled on a regular basis.
Every Saturday morning for over 20 years, I have gone out to breakfast and coffee and some kind of treat with one of my girls or a friend and then ended with a long walk and lots of friendship talking. This rhythm is one of the most Lifegiving commitments I have practiced.
It is essential that we have godly women of wisdom pouring into us, speaking words of encouragement over us, someone who is in our corner. No matter how busy or hectic your world is, whatever state your to-do list is in, make time to at least talk with a friend on the phone, or meet up for a coffee and croissant.
